Twinings-Ovo Latam is responsible for delivering Ovomaltine and Twinings brands to Latin American markets, making them relevant to a wide range of consumers. It is the division that presented the fastest growing TwO business worldwide, with a significant potential for further expansion. Our team of 18 people is based in São Paulo, with one team member in Santiago, Chile. We offer variety, challenge and flexibility in an environment that celebrates differences and empowers collaboration.
